What are synonyms for Claim against an … WebA breach of contract claim can also be commenced against a deceased’s estate where the deceased breached a contract (often an oral contract) by failing to execute a Will leaving a bequest or certain asset to an individual. The disappointed individual often has agreed to perform (and by death has performed) services in exchange for the bequest.

WebINSTRUCTIONS: Claims MUST be filed with the Probate Court of the county in which the Decedent’s Estate is under administration and may be delivered or mailed to the fiduciary appointed to administer the Estate (see SCPC 62-3-803, 62-3-804, and 62-3-806).
